4. Assembly and Setup
Follow these steps to assemble your IScooter EB3 Electric Bike:
- Unpack: Carefully remove all components from the packaging.
- Install Front Wheel: Attach the front wheel to the fork using the quick release skewer. Ensure it is centered and securely tightened.
- Install Handlebars: Insert the handlebar stem into the fork tube and tighten the bolts. Adjust the handlebar angle for comfortable riding.
- Attach Fenders: Secure the front and rear fenders to their respective mounting points.
- Install Saddle: Insert the seat post into the frame's seat tube and adjust the height. Tighten the quick release lever or bolt.
- Attach Pedals: Identify the left (L) and right (R) pedals. The left pedal screws counter-clockwise, and the right pedal screws clockwise. Tighten them firmly.
- Install Battery: Insert the 36V 10.4AH lithium battery into its designated slot on the frame. Use the provided keys to lock it in place.
- Initial Charge: Before your first ride, fully charge the battery using the provided charger.


5. Operating Instructions
Familiarize yourself with the controls and functions of your EB3 electric bike.
5.1 Powering On/Off
Press and hold the power button on the LCD display to turn the bike's electrical system on or off.
5.2 LCD Intelligent Riding Display
The smart LCD dashboard provides real-time riding information:

- AVG MAX SPEED: Average and Maximum Speed.
- DST: Distance traveled.
- ODO: Odometer (total distance).
- VOL: Battery Voltage.
- TRIP: Trip distance.
- TIME: Riding time.
- BMS: Battery Management System indicator.
- ASSIST: Pedal assist level (adjust with '+' and '-' buttons).
- KM/MILE: Unit selection.
5.3 Gear Shifting
Use the gear shifter on the handlebar to change between the 5 available speed gears. Shift smoothly to avoid damage to the drivetrain.
5.4 Electric Assist Levels
The EB3 features multiple pedal assist levels. Use the '+' and '-' buttons on the display to increase or decrease the motor assistance. Higher levels provide more power, while lower levels conserve battery life.
5.5 Braking System
The bike is equipped with Electronic Dual Disc Brakes for effective stopping power. Apply both brake levers evenly for controlled braking.

5.6 Lights and Horn
The EB3 comes with bright front and rear LED lights for enhanced visibility. Use the headlight switch on the handlebar to turn them on/off. The horn switch activates the integrated horn.

5.7 Charging the Battery
Connect the charger to the battery charging port and then to a power outlet. The indicator light on the charger will show the charging status. Disconnect once fully charged.

6. Maintenance
Regular maintenance ensures the longevity and safe operation of your e-bike.
6.1 Battery Care
- Charge the battery regularly, even if not in use, to maintain its health.
- Store the battery in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ight and extreme temperatures.
- Avoid completely draining the battery before recharging.
- If storing for extended periods, charge the battery to 50-70% and check it monthly.
6.2 Tire Maintenance
The 26-inch wear-resistant inflatable tires with thickened inner tubes require proper inflation.

- Check tire pressure before each ride and inflate to the recommended PSI (usually found on the tire sidewall).
- Inspect tires for wear, cuts, or punctures.
6.3 Brake Inspection
- Regularly check the brake levers for proper tension and responsiveness.
- Inspect disc brake pads for wear and replace them if necessary.
- Ensure brake cables are not frayed or damaged.
6.4 General Cleaning
- Clean the bike regularly with a damp cloth and mild soap. Avoid high-pressure washing directly on electrical components.
- Lubricate the chain periodically to ensure smooth operation.
7. Troubleshooting
Here are some common issues and their potential solutions:
| Problem | Possible Cause | Solution |
|---|---|---|
| Bike does not power on | Battery not charged or not properly installed. | Ensure battery is fully charged and securely locked in place. Check connections. |
| Motor not assisting | Pedal assist level too low, or a sensor issue. | Increase pedal assist level on the display. Check for any error codes on the BMS indicator. |
| Brakes feel weak | Worn brake pads or loose cables. | Inspect brake pads and replace if worn. Adjust brake cable tension. |
| Unusual noises during ride | Loose components, dry chain, or debris. | Check all bolts and fasteners. Lubricate chain. Inspect for foreign objects. |

8. Specifications
| Feature | Specification |
|---|---|
| Model Number | IScooter EB3 |
| Certification | CE |
| Rated Passenger Capacity | Two Seat |
| Style | Luxury Type |
| Max Speed | 32 km/h |
| Range per Power | 74 - 100 km |
| Motor Wattage | 500W Brushless Motor |
| Power Supply | Lithium Battery |
| Voltage | 36V |
| Battery Capacity | 10.4AH |
| Folded | No |
| Wheel Size | 26 inches |
| Frame Material | Aluminum alloy |
| Climbing Ability | 25° |
| Dimensions (L x H x W) | 172 cm x 104 cm x 67 cm |
| Product Weight | 25.0 kg |
